Résumé
In the title compound, C16H9BrO4, the dihedral angle between the chromen-2-
one ring system (r.m.s. deviation = 0.006 A ˚ ) and the bromobenzene ring is
10.29 (6)�. In the crystal, the molecules are connected through C—H� � �O
hydrogen bonds and �–� stacking interactions. According to a Hirshfeld surface
analysis, H� � �H (22.4%), O� � �H/H� � �O (23.6%) and C� � �H/H� � �C (21%)
interactions are the most significant contributors to the crystal packing.
